Handover note for review, Torben to Ilsa: the Pairloom matching service was seeing 300ms GC pauses during peak rebalance. I switched to the concurrent collector, pre-sized the arena pools, and moved match-state off-heap. Please check the pause histogram assertions in the new soak test. The service should now start with the configuration below.

deployment values, kajep-kageg:
[praix]
host = praix.paliqcorp.corp
user = praix_svc
database = praix_prod

Subject: Handover — Order-Cutoff Rule for Crumbleport Bakery Plugins

Hi Verany,

Before I head out, here's the state of the order-cutoff logic that external plugin authors depend on. Orders placed after 14:00 local time roll to the next baking day; the rule lives in the `cutoff_windows` table, keyed by storefront. Plugins must never hardcode the hour — always read it at checkout time, since Crumbleport managers adjust it seasonally. For your sandbox testing against the shared staging replica, use the connection string below.

Thanks,
Odran

replica DSN, kajep-yahag: mssql://praok_svc:iF@db-8d68.plorvaio.local:5432/eliion

## Escalation: Soft Deletes in `orders`

Rows in the Cartwheel `orders` table are never hard-deleted; `deleted_at` is set and downstream syncs filter on it. If you see soft-deleted rows reappearing in reports, first check the nightly reconciler job — it occasionally re-nulls timestamps after a failed batch. Do not run manual UPDATEs; the audit trigger will flag them. If the reconciler logs show repeated rollbacks, escalate to the data-integrity rotation at the address below.

pager mailbox: silael.sorwyn.tamius@zemvarsys.corp

### Account Recovery — Catalogue Import (Lintwood)

Quick one for review: when the Lintwood catalogue import wipes a patron's session table, the recovery flow re-seeds accounts from the nightly snapshot. Check that the importer skips locked accounts — last time it didn't. To rerun recovery against staging you'll need the vault passphrase, which is appended just below.

recovery phrase for yafof-tajof: julmir-kelax-julvan-holath-belvan-holir-ralael-ralvan-ralath-julvan-silmir-istmir-kaswyn-ulamir